Spaces:
Sleeping
Sleeping
Commit
·
6cd1be3
1
Parent(s):
f32fe41
updated prompts
Browse files- prompts.yaml +11 -0
prompts.yaml
CHANGED
|
@@ -42,6 +42,17 @@
|
|
| 42 |
8. ALWAYS end with final_answer tool - this is mandatory!
|
| 43 |
9. **EXACT MATCH CRITICAL**: Your final_answer must match the ground truth EXACTLY - check format, spacing, capitalization, punctuation!
|
| 44 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 45 |
**EXACT MATCH FORMATTING GUIDELINES:**
|
| 46 |
- Numbers: Use exact format (e.g., "1,234" vs "1234", "3.14" vs "3.140")
|
| 47 |
- Dates: Match expected format exactly (e.g., "January 1, 2024" vs "Jan 1, 2024" vs "2024-01-01")
|
|
|
|
| 42 |
8. ALWAYS end with final_answer tool - this is mandatory!
|
| 43 |
9. **EXACT MATCH CRITICAL**: Your final_answer must match the ground truth EXACTLY - check format, spacing, capitalization, punctuation!
|
| 44 |
|
| 45 |
+
**CRITICAL UNIT CONVERSION RULE:**
|
| 46 |
+
When a question asks "how many thousand X" or "how many million Y":
|
| 47 |
+
1. Calculate the total in base units (hours, dollars, etc.)
|
| 48 |
+
2. Convert to the requested unit by dividing (÷1000 for thousands, ÷1,000,000 for millions)
|
| 49 |
+
3. Round the converted value, NOT the base value
|
| 50 |
+
|
| 51 |
+
WRONG: round(17000/1000) * 1000 = 17000
|
| 52 |
+
RIGHT: round(17000/1000) = round(17) = 17
|
| 53 |
+
|
| 54 |
+
The question "how many thousand hours" wants the answer 17, not 17000.
|
| 55 |
+
|
| 56 |
**EXACT MATCH FORMATTING GUIDELINES:**
|
| 57 |
- Numbers: Use exact format (e.g., "1,234" vs "1234", "3.14" vs "3.140")
|
| 58 |
- Dates: Match expected format exactly (e.g., "January 1, 2024" vs "Jan 1, 2024" vs "2024-01-01")
|